Transaction cf77d2df2a202e236e106d491c67916148cc19772cf4857d7c455c11c2a65706

3 Input
2 Outputs
  • cf77d2df2a202e236e106d491c67916148cc19772cf4857d7c455c11c2a65706:0
  • value  20000000
    address  3MQu1cxN8D5a9NQwBaX3G9E5wpVqPMeshT
  • cf77d2df2a202e236e106d491c67916148cc19772cf4857d7c455c11c2a65706:1
  • value  5855904
    address  3KDtUBKiMFhDqsjZ64EV6Sh4oEHwtHMkUG